πŸ“‹ Key Responsibilities

βœ… Own the planning, execution, and post-event analysis of all US-based industry events, sponsorships, client activations, and internal gatherings.

βœ… Work cross-functionally with sales, partnerships, and leadership to align event strategy with business goals and audience engagement.

βœ… Manage vendor relationships, budgets, timelines, and logistics for conferences and hosted events.

βœ… Collaborate with content and design teams to develop event collateral, signage, swag, and branded materials.

βœ… Track and measure the success of each event, capturing insights to improve performance and ROI.

βœ… Support broader brand marketing initiatives, especially around tentpole moments and strategic partnerships.

βœ… Represent the brand externally with confidence and professionalism, serving as an ambassador of Channel Factory at events.

βœ… All additional duties as assigned.

πŸ” Company Context

Industry: Channel Factory is a global technology and data platform that maximizes both performance efficiency and contextual suitability, delivering contextual performance for advertisers on YouTube.

Company Size: 501-1,000 employees (as of 2025)

Founded: 2010, with headquarters in City of Industry, California, and global offices across 20+ cities/countries

Company Description:

  • Channel Factory provides intelligent marketing solutions for the next generation of contextual safety, suitability, and performance for brands and agencies.
  • The company's platform helps marketers implement, automate, and scale their marketing programs across the world’s largest video library, YouTube, and emerging growth channels.
  • Channel Factory embodies a strong start-up culture that values diversity, collaboration, and results.
